Hadith 5541
Narrated Salim: that Ibn `Umar disliked the branding of animals on the face. Ibn `Umar said, "The Prophet forbade beating (animals) on the face."
Hadith 5542
حَدَّثَنَا
أَبُو الْوَلِيدِ ، حَدَّثَنَا
شُعْبَةُ ، عَنْ
هِشَامِ بْنِ زَيْدٍ ، عَنْ
أَنَسٍ ، قَالَ : " دَخَلْتُ عَلَى النَّبِيِّ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 بِأَخٍ لِي يُحَنِّكُهُ وَهُوَ فِي مِرْبَدٍ لَهُ ، فَرَأَيْتُهُ يَسِمُ شَاةً ، حَسِبْتُهُ قَالَ : فِي آذَانِهَا " .
Narrated Anas: I brought a brother of mine to the Prophet to do Tahnik for him while the Prophet was in a sheep fold of his, and I saw him branding a sheep. (The sub-narrator said: I think Anas said, branding it on the ear.)
